CIEE'S Living Room Concert
This last Sunday my first live concert in Seoul (and probably the only one will get to attend) due to the Covid-19 restrictions here in Seoul we weren't able to see the concert in person and meet the Jungheum Band. So, they graciously held their concert privately on YouTube for CIEE. They were so sweet and communicated with us over messages on the live. The group consists of two members 정민경 the vocalist and 황명흠 the guitarist. We listened to their original songs and some BTS, TWICE, and a few Disney song covers. We enjoyed their music while eating delicious fried chicken! That day was also my best friend's birthday and they surprised her by singer her happy birthday! It was so sweet and kind of them to give her that gift. This is for sure one of my favorite memories of the trip! Also, I want to thank Tina and Teddy two of our Program coordinators for setting up this event and supplying our meal and even a cake for my friend's birthday! I am so grateful for this experience you guys gave us. I am also proud to say that I am now a loyal listener to the Jungheum band!
